Output 2fa8b34e66346ae34e49a99df81c895b918a5ca98ddc49027edf26d52e7c569b:0

value
40348751189
script pubkey
OP_0 OP_PUSHBYTES_20 82c370991e9e489d1119b7d8fd1d157c0063bc64
address
tb1qstphpxg7neyf6ygeklv068g40sqx80ryuxdw9u
transaction
2fa8b34e66346ae34e49a99df81c895b918a5ca98ddc49027edf26d52e7c569b
confirmations
71445
spent
true